Location
Chelveston is a small village in East Northamptonshire with popular public house and village hall. It is ideally located for road links including access to the A45 linking to the A6 and recently upgraded A14, and is in close proximity to the towns of Raunds, Rushden, Higham Ferrers and Irthlingborough. Nearby Stanwick Lakes offers extensive play areas to keep families entertained, with acres of wide-open spaces and paths for walkers and cyclists as well as a café and visitor centre. Rushden Lakes shopping centre features a variety of shops and eateries from department stores to everyday essentials, a wide variety of restaurants and cafés and activities including indoor climbing and trampolining, a soft play facility and multiplex cinema. Mainline train services operate from Kettering, Wellingborough and Corby to London St. Pancras International with a journey time of around one hour.
